Transaction 329ea51b2b4def8fc276759714d0c1603f5349ac763a67a8f89fbf9de7d10c22
2 Input
2 Outputs
- 329ea51b2b4def8fc276759714d0c1603f5349ac763a67a8f89fbf9de7d10c22:0
- 329ea51b2b4def8fc276759714d0c1603f5349ac763a67a8f89fbf9de7d10c22:1
value 17442463
address 15Sr9cqvLvkvoXq6t6b1sCPX3p6QsNkreH
value 70000000
address 348fnXghoxyfhVQxB8nhMGTNBECF4Pu2Lp